Output 4ec139462f0d465466afa367c64905d3d8ca3bf877454e3f19a1be0b4d05f4e5:63

value
103071072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a059cd45a4071e45586a747ebcf93a19cde42fe OP_EQUAL
address
M8p9iKWBV7C6NDDfxoJWHBTEXRC4bpvCWB
transaction
4ec139462f0d465466afa367c64905d3d8ca3bf877454e3f19a1be0b4d05f4e5
spent
true